Izici
Ukwakhiwa okuhlanganisiwe kuvumela ukufakwa nokushintshwa okusheshayo nokulula. Umklamo uhambisana nezindinganiso ze-DIN24960, ISO 3069 kanye ne-ANSI B73.1 M-1991.
Umklamo we-bellows omusha usekelwa yingcindezi futhi ngeke ugobe noma ugoqeke ngaphansi kwengcindezi ephezulu.
Isiphethu esingavali, esine-coil eyodwa sigcina ubuso be-seal buvaliwe futhi silandelela kahle phakathi nazo zonke izigaba zokusebenza.
Ukushayela okuhle phakathi kwama-tang axhumene ngeke kushelele noma kugqashuke phakathi kwezimo ezingathandeki.
Itholakala ngohlu olubanzi kakhulu lwezinketho zezinto zokwakha, kufaka phakathi ama-silicon carbide asebenza kahle kakhulu.
Ibanga Lokusebenza
Ububanzi bomgodi: d1=10…100mm(0.375” …3.000”)
Ingcindezi: p=0…1.2Mpa(174psi)
Izinga lokushisa: t = -20 °C …150 °C(-4°F kuya ku-302°F)
Ijubane lokushelela: Vg≤13m/s(42.6ft/m)
Amanothi:Ububanzi bokucindezela, izinga lokushisa kanye nesivinini esishelelayo buxhomeke ezintweni zokuhlanganiswa kwezimpawu
Izinto Zokuhlanganisa
Ubuso obujikelezayo
I-carbon graphite resin efakwe emanzini
Ikhabhoni ecindezela ukushisa
I-silicon carbide (RBSIC)
Isihlalo Esimile
I-aluminium oxide (i-Ceramic)
I-silicon carbide (RBSIC)
I-Tungsten carbide
I-Elastomer
Irabha ye-Nitrile-Butadiene (NBR)
Irabha ye-Fluorocarbon (i-Viton)
I-Ethylene-Propylene-Diene (EPDM)
Intwasahlobo
Insimbi engagqwali (SUS304, SUS316)
Izingxenye Zensimbi
Insimbi engagqwali (SUS304, SUS316)
